Reading Closed Testing Engagement Metrics in Play Console
TL;DR
To verify your testers are active, check the 'Active Devices' metric under the Statistics tab, and the 'Daily Active Users (DAU)' metric under the Engagement tab. Remember that Play Console data lags by 24-48 hours.
Where is the 14-Day Progress Bar?
Google Play Console provides a dashboard card showing how many testers are opted-in and how many days are left in your 14-day requirement. However, this high-level widget doesn't tell you if the testers are actually using the app.
To ensure you don't fail the engagement check, you must manually read your analytics.
Metric 1: Active Devices
Navigate to Statistics > Users > Active Devices. This chart shows how many physical devices currently have your application installed.
- What to look for: This line should remain flat or grow above 12. If the line drops sharply, it means testers are uninstalling your app, putting your streak at risk.
Metric 2: Daily Active Users (DAU)
Navigate to Engagement > Active Users. This is the most critical chart for passing the review. It shows how many unique testers opened the app on any given day.
- What to look for: You want a healthy, fluctuating line showing 6 to 10 testers engaging daily. A flatline at 0 means your app is installed but ignored—a primary cause for rejection.

Navigate to Quality > Android Vitals > Crashes and ANRs.
While you obviously want a stable app, seeing 1 or 2 minor crash logs here during closed testing is actually a positive signal to Google's algorithm. It proves that real devices are interacting with your app and generating authentic system logs.
The 48-Hour Delay
Always remember that the Play Console is an aggregate reporting tool. The data you see today reflects tester activity from 24 to 48 hours ago. Do not panic if Day 1 statistics look empty; check back on Day 3 to verify the initial install surge.
